On this episode of listener questions, we start by taking on the eternal golf question:

  • How do I transition my skills from the range to the golf course.  Why is that so difficult and shouldn't tee shots specifically be the same?
  • How do I know when equipment is the issue?  Can the club design or shaft actually make bad shots worse?  
  • Eric and Rob discuss the importance of footwear and tell a story about a good golfer who got the "shanks" because of his golf shoes.  
  • How do I determine what shot or club to hit for a tee shot?  Is driver always the best play?  
    • Why 3 woods used to be more common for tee shots but now are rarely the correct play.
    • Using technology to determine aiming strategy. 
    • How hole design impacts club selection.  
    • Is the rough a big deal?
    • Avoiding penalties and disruptors.
